VIDYAVARDHINI'S COLLEGE OF ENGINEERING AND TECHNOLOGY (VCET) The circular emblem of Vidyavardhini's College of Engineering and Technology (VCET) features a circle with an eight-petalled lotus spread supporting the traditional Maharashtrian lamp ‘ Laman Diva ’. The motifs are ensconced by a circular border inscribed with the name of the college and its motto in Sanskrit ‘सा विद्या या विमुक्तये’ ( Rishi Parāśara , 1,19.41, Viṣṇu Purāṇa ) meaning ‘ Knowledge is One That Liberates ’. The eight-petaled lotus symbolises purity, spiritual awakening, and higher consciousness in Hinduism and Buddhism. It is often associated with the eight forms of the goddess Lakshmi ( Ashta Lakshmi ), representing wealth, fertility, and courage . In yoga and spiritual contexts , the eight petals can represent the different mental modifications or stages on the path to enlightenment, including the Svadhishthana chakra , which is linked to the element of water .
